What Are Mobile Connectors?
Mobile connectors are hardware or software tools that facilitate the transfer of data, charging, or communication between mobile devices and other systems. Support for multiple operating systems like Android, iOS, and Windows ensures versatility and broad compatibility.
Top Mobile Connectors Supporting Multiple OS
- USB-C Multi-Platform Connectors
- Wireless Bluetooth Adapters
- Universal Docking Stations
- OTG (On-The-Go) Adapters
USB-C Multi-Platform Connectors
USB-C connectors are increasingly popular due to their universal compatibility. They support fast data transfer and charging across Android devices, Windows laptops, and even some iPads. Many multi-port USB-C hubs include HDMI, SD card readers, and Ethernet ports, making them versatile tools for various OS environments.
Wireless Bluetooth Adapters
Bluetooth adapters enable wireless connection between devices regardless of their operating system. They are ideal for connecting peripherals like keyboards, mice, and audio devices across Android, iOS, and Windows platforms without the need for cables.
Universal Docking Stations
Docking stations support multiple OS by providing a single connection point for monitors, keyboards, and other peripherals. Many are compatible with Windows, macOS, and Chrome OS, making them excellent for multi-OS environments in workplaces or educational settings.
OTG (On-The-Go) Adapters
OTG adapters allow smartphones and tablets to connect directly to USB devices like flash drives, keyboards, or cameras. They support both Android and iOS (with specific adapters), enabling users to transfer data or expand device functionality easily.
